Output 98d30ac080328cb1e623c85ffcf6d3d59dab50cf0a79c0322dc0474aa2b93566:82

value
376126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4593d584ea42b8e2d8745f972a9037afd5e889de OP_EQUAL
address
382ueUFG4oGTeY9q6qx1ghRPAv5NCtk79T
transaction
98d30ac080328cb1e623c85ffcf6d3d59dab50cf0a79c0322dc0474aa2b93566
spent
true